UNHCR: 11,000 Rohingyas  entered  Bangladesh in 24 hours

Geneva Oct 11: United Nations refugee agency on Tuesday has said that Around 11,000 Rohingyas crossed over into neighboring Bangladesh in a single day.

"We're back in a situation of full alert as far as influxes are concerned. It is a big increase to see 11,000," UN High Commissioner for Refugees spokesperson Adrian Edwards said at a news briefing.

"UNHCR is working with the Bangladesh authorities on a transit center to prepare for a potential refugee influx in the coming days," he added.



There are reports that nearly half a million refugees have entered in Bangladesh since August 25 after the Rohingya Crisis in Myanmar has intensified.

Currently, the crisis is still ongoing and many people are crossing the border however the Myanmar government has initiated the steps to resolve the crisis.
